Abstract

The utility model discloses building trade Sand screen, including charging aperture and screen drum, the charging aperture lower end is connected with material blanking tube, and sieve plate is installed inside material blanking tube, described sieve plate one end is fixed with discharging slide plate, and the material blanking tube above discharging slide plate offers top discharge mouth, the material blanking tube lower end is connected with shell, the enclosure is provided with screen drum, and shell left end is fixed with motor, the motor is connected with axis of rotation, and rotating shaft is fixed through feed well with the connecting rod inside round slider, the screen drum both ends are fixed with round slider, and round slider is slidably connected with slide rail, helical blade is fixed with inside the screen drum, and screen drum outer wall from left to right offers the first sieve aperture successively, second sieve aperture and the 3rd sieve aperture, first sieve aperture, second sieve aperture and the shell of the 3rd sieve aperture lower end are provided with the outlet of sieve material.The utility model is simple in construction, easy to use, and operating efficiency is high, fine using husky screening to building.

Background technology
At present, sand sieving machine also known as nonirrigated farmland sieve large junk, sand-stone separator, river course, reservoir, the sandstone separation of coal yard are applied to Equipment, sand sieving machine are to copy the artificial operation principle for utilizing inclined sieve mesh screen sand, using horizontal roll screen barrel, and ensure that stream is being sieved Cylinder in multi-turn internal helical blades between can continuously roller screen five circle more than so that sand material roll, slide repeatedly and fully it is discrete, divide From mutually being pushed different from big small powder caused by tilting roller screen, pile things on, screening process is hasty, also different from tilting vibratory sieve Big small powder tramp, batch mixing, but in the market sand sieving machine is complicated, operating efficiency is low, not fine using husky screening to building.

Embodiment
Below in conjunction with the accompanying drawing in the utility model embodiment, the technical scheme in the embodiment of the utility model is carried out Clearly and completely describing, it is clear that described embodiment is only the utility model part of the embodiment, rather than whole Emb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are not under the premise of creative work is made The every other embodiment obtained, belong to the scope of the utility model protection.
Refer to Fig. 1-3, a kind of embodiment provided by the utility model:Building trade Sand screen, including the He of charging aperture 1 Screen drum 8, the lower end of charging aperture 1 is connected with material blanking tube 18, and sieve plate 2 is provided with inside material blanking tube 18, and the one end of sieve plate 2 is fixed with discharging Slide plate 20, and the material blanking tube 18 for the top of slide plate 20 that discharges offers top discharge mouth 19, the lower end of material blanking tube 18 is connected with shell 6, outside Shell 6 is internally provided with screen drum 8, and the left end of shell 6 is fixed with motor 3, and motor 3 is rotatablely connected with rotating shaft 4, and rotating shaft 4 pass through into Hopper 5 is fixed with the connecting rod 12 inside round slider 16, and the both ends of screen drum 8 are fixed with round slider 16, and round slider 16 with Slide rail 17 is slidably connected, and helical blade 9 is fixed with inside institute's cylinder 8, and the outer wall of screen drum 8 from left to right offers the first sieve aperture successively 13rd, the second sieve aperture 14 and the 3rd sieve aperture 15, the shell 6 of the first sieve aperture 13, the second sieve aperture 14 and the lower end of the 3rd sieve aperture 15 are provided with Sieve material outlet 7, the sieve plate 2 is slidably connected with material blanking tube 18, and motor 3 is connected by wire with controlling switch, and controlling switch The outer wall of shell 6 is installed on, feed well 5 is fixed on the lower section of material blanking tube 18, and the upper end of feed well 5 offers blanking entrance, the bottom of shell 6 Portion is fixed with support 10, and the left end of screen drum 8 is connected by slide rail 17 with feed well 5, and the right-hand member of screen drum 8 passes through slide rail 17 and shell 6 Connection, the shell 6 of the right-hand member of screen drum 8 offer main discharging opening 11, and helical blade 9 is in the first sieve aperture 13, the second sieve aperture 14 and the 3rd Five spiralization cycles are provided with sieve aperture 15, the slot size of the first sieve aperture 13, the second sieve aperture 14 and the 3rd sieve aperture 15 is step by step It is incremented by.
Operation principle:The mixed material not screened during use is entered in material blanking tube 18 by charging aperture 1, inside material blanking tube 18 Sieve plate 2 sifts out the non-husky and bulky grain object mixed in sand, and by discharging, slide plate 20 skids off, and the material after sieve plate 2 holds logical Cross feed well 5 to enter in screen drum 8, screen drum 8 is fixed by the connecting rod 12 in round slider 16 with rotating shaft 4, is rotated by motor 3 Screen drum 8 is set to be rotated between two wood side-guides 17, material moves along the internal helical blades 9 of screen drum 8 in roller 8, passes through the first sieve aperture 13rd, the second sieve aperture 14 and the 3rd sieve aperture 15 make diameter be fallen less than the grains of sand of sieve aperture, and logical sieving materials outlet 7 drops out, and does not spill The grains of sand are discharged from main discharging opening 11.
